Reseña del libro "Within a Budding Grove (en Inglés)"

In "Within a Budding Grove," the second volume of Marcel Proust's monumental work "In Search of Lost Time," the narrative delves into the complexities of adolescence and the search for identity through lyrical prose. The literary style employs a stream-of-consciousness technique, presenting thoughts and sensations with dazzling richness that parallels the protagonist's journey into the intricacies of love, friendship, and societal observation. The novel captures moments of consciousness and the subtle shifts in perception as the young narrator grapples with the ephemeral nature of time and experience, all set against the backdrop of elite French society at the turn of the 20th century. Marcel Proust, a French novelist, draws deeply from his own experiences of youth and social dynamics to craft this evocative portrayal of the coming-of-age narrative. His intimate acquaintance with the artistic and social milieu of his time informs the characters and settings, reflecting the author's profound engagement with themes of memory, desire, and the passage of time. Proust's exquisite attention to detail and mastery of introspection resonate with readers who seek a deeper understanding of human relationships and their transient nature. "Within a Budding Grove" is a must-read for those intrigued by the searches of personal identity and the intricacies of time. Proust's eloquent exploration of youth, infused with moments of heartache and beauty, remains a timeless reflection relevant to every generation. This volume invites readers to ponder their own memories and the delicate dance of existence that shape who we are.
